常熟银行:2024年三季报点评:业绩维持高增,不良净生成边际改善

Investment Rating - The report maintains a "Recommended" rating for Changshu Bank (601128) with a target price of 8.00 CNY, compared to the current price of 7.17 CNY [1]. Core Views - Changshu Bank's performance continues to show high growth, with a year-on-year increase in operating income of 11.3% to 8.37 billion CNY and a net profit attributable to shareholders of 2.98 billion CNY, reflecting an 18.2% growth [1][2]. - The bank's asset quality remains strong, with a slight increase in the non-performing loan (NPL) ratio to 0.77% and a decrease in the provision coverage ratio to 528.4% [1]. - The report highlights a marginal improvement in the net generation of non-performing loans, which decreased by 63 basis points to 0.59% [1]. Summary by Sections Financial Performance - For the first three quarters of 2024, operating income reached 8.37 billion CNY, with a year-on-year growth of 11.3%, slightly down from the first half of 2024 [1]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was 2.98 billion CNY, with an 18.2% year-on-year increase, showing a slight deceleration compared to the first half of 2024 [1]. - The bank's net interest income grew by 6.3% year-on-year, while non-interest income saw a significant decline of 20.2% [1]. Asset Quality - The NPL ratio increased slightly by 1 basis point to 0.77%, which is still considered excellent within the industry [1]. - The provision coverage ratio decreased by 10.3 percentage points to 528.4%, indicating a strong risk mitigation capacity [1]. - The report notes that the marginal improvement in asset quality is supported by a decrease in the net generation rate of non-performing loans [1]. Loan and Deposit Growth - As of the end of Q3 2024, the growth rates for interest-earning assets and loans were 10.3% and 9.7% year-on-year, respectively, with a decline in growth rates compared to previous quarters [1]. - Corporate loans maintained a robust growth rate, while retail loan demand remained weak, leading to a slowdown in overall loan growth [1]. Future Outlook - The report projects revenue growth rates of 11.4%, 12.4%, and 13.7% for 2024, 2025, and 2026, respectively, with net profit growth rates of 17.2%, 19.9%, and 19.4% for the same years [1][2]. - The current stock price corresponds to a 2025 estimated price-to-book (PB) ratio of 0.67X, with a target PB of 0.75X for 2025 [1].
